Output 4b3a3ae5c60f97d9cd3e05caba608d021e130aabba982d3356652e6834705834:11

value
32524766
script pubkey
OP_0 OP_PUSHBYTES_20 95873959f02e88db7dbacd09c9cd2bd190496659
address
bc1qjkrnjk0s96ydkld6e5yunnft6xgyjeje9g55r0
transaction
4b3a3ae5c60f97d9cd3e05caba608d021e130aabba982d3356652e6834705834
confirmations
75947
spent
true